Last Love Affair



A promise to keep
my sheets free.
Free from toxic souls.
Souls that create a stench of lies.
Lies low, to not be discovered.
Discovered holes that leaked words, broken.
Broken in beds; never really felt so good.
So good, to carry on like we'd never get uncovered.
Uncovered the truths that we'd never be.
Never be in an Affair, Again.
Again is never.
Never no more.
no More
kisses.
Kisses to our last love Affair!
